Karma
Karma is a font designed to support both Devanagari and Latin scripts, making it beneficial for users needing multilingual typography. Despite its niche utility, the project's lack of recent updates and community engagement may affect its reliability.
Karma is a font that supports Devanagari and Latin scripts for use in applications requiring multilingual text.

Noto Serif Devanagari
Noto Serif Devanagari is a high-quality font designed for Devanagari script, ideal for languages like Hindi and Nepali. It offers clear readability and aesthetic appeal, benefiting designers, publishers, and users requiring Devanagari support.
Provides a font for displaying text in the Devanagari script.
